Defining Organic Farming Standards
Organic farming standards encompass a set of regulatory criteria designed to govern the practices associated with organic agricultural production. These standards aim to promote sustainable farming methods that prioritize environmental health, biodiversity, and soil fertility.
At the core of organic farming standards is the prohibition of synthetic fertilizers and pesticides, replacing them with natural alternatives. Additionally, these standards require the humane treatment of livestock, ensuring that animals are raised without the use of growth hormones or antibiotics.
Organic farming standards vary by country and are typically established by national and international regulatory bodies. Compliance with these standards is crucial for producers seeking organic certification, which provides consumers with assurances regarding the integrity of organic products.

Certification Process for Organic Farming Standards
The certification process for Organic Farming Standards involves validating that farming practices meet established organic criteria. This process ensures compliance with regulatory requirements, allowing farmers to market their products as organic.
Farmers must engage with accredited certifying agents, who conduct thorough inspections of farming operations. The inspection typically includes:
- Assessing soil management practices.
- Reviewing pest control measures.
- Evaluating record-keeping.
Upon successful inspection, farmers receive certification, allowing them to label their produce as organic. This certification must be renewed periodically, ensuring continuous adherence to Organic Farming Standards.
Farmers are also required to maintain detailed records throughout the certification period. These records should document every aspect of their farming practices, including inputs used, crop rotations, and any pest management strategies employed. Crop Rotation and Diversity
Crop rotation refers to the agricultural practice of alternating different types of crops in a specific sequence over time within the same field. This technique is vital for maintaining soil health, optimizing nutrient use, and reducing pest and disease prevalence. Diversity within crop systems enhances resilience and productivity.
Implementing crop rotation involves several key principles:
- Varying crops from season to season to disrupt pest life cycles.
- Selecting crops that utilize different soil nutrients, thereby preventing depletion.
- Incorporating legumes, which can fix nitrogen in the soil, improving fertility.
Diversity in organic farming not only enhances ecological balance but also mitigates the risks associated with monoculture. A diverse system can foster beneficial microorganisms and insects, promoting a healthier agricultural ecosystem. Sustainable Soil Management
Sustainable soil management refers to practices aimed at maintaining and improving soil health and fertility over time. This approach focuses on enhancing organic matter content, minimizing erosion, and preserving biodiversity within the soil ecosystem.
Key techniques in sustainable soil management include cover cropping, which protects soil from erosion and builds organic matter. Crop rotation is another vital practice, preventing nutrient depletion and breaking pest cycles, thereby promoting a healthier soil environment.
Additionally, minimizing the use of synthetic fertilizers and pesticides supports organic farming standards by encouraging natural soil processes. Farmers are urged to utilize composting and biological amendments to enhance soil structure and nutrient availability sustainably.

Record-Keeping Obligations
Record-keeping obligations under organic farming standards involve detailed documentation of agricultural practices and inputs used. This practice is mandatory for all certified organic operations, serving as a vital tool for traceability and compliance with established regulations.
Farmers are required to maintain comprehensive records that include information on seed sources, production practices, pesticide applications, and sales. These meticulous records ensure that organic farming standards are met and provide a clear audit trail for regulatory bodies during inspections.
In practice, records should be kept in an organized manner, allowing for easy access and review. This facilitates the verification of compliance with organic farming standards and helps in addressing any compliance issues that may arise.
Failure to adhere to these record-keeping obligations can result in severe consequences, including loss of certification. Therefore, maintaining accurate and up-to-date records is not only a legal requirement but also crucial for the sustainability and credibility of organic farming operations.
Use of Approved Inputs and Practices
The use of approved inputs and practices refers to the specific materials, substances, and methods permitted within organic farming to ensure compliance with established organic farming standards. These inputs include fertilizers, pest control substances, and soil amendments that must meet stringent criteria outlined by regulatory bodies.
Organic farmers are mandated to use inputs derived from natural sources, avoiding synthetic chemicals that could compromise the integrity of organic certification. For instance, organic fertilizers such as compost or manure are encouraged, alongside botanical pesticides like neem oil, which bolster crop health without adverse environmental impacts.
Practices in organic farming are intended to promote biodiversity and sustainability. Techniques such as crop rotation, which helps prevent soil depletion and pest infestation, and the use of cover crops to enhance soil fertility, are integral to complying with organic standards. Financial Barriers
Organic farming standards can impose significant financial barriers for farmers transitioning from conventional to organic practices. The initial costs associated with certification, compliance with stringent regulations, and potential reductions in yield during the transition can deter many agricultural producers.
Farmers often face increased expenses for organic inputs, such as natural fertilizers and pest control methods, which are typically higher in cost compared to synthetic alternatives. Additionally, the adoption of organic practices, such as crop rotation and sustainable soil management, may require investments in new equipment or infrastructure.
These financial challenges can be particularly daunting for smallholder farmers, who may lack access to credit or assistance programs. The monetary investment needed to meet organic farming standards can exacerbate existing economic vulnerabilities, creating a barrier to entry into the organic market.
Finally, the uncertainty of achieving premium prices for organic goods further complicates the financial landscape. Farmers may hesitate to fully commit to organic practices without assurance of sufficient market demand to justify the investment, increasing the risk associated with pursuing organic farming standards.

Emerging Trends in Organic Farming Standards
In recent years, the landscape of organic farming standards has seen notable changes influenced by consumer demand and technological advancements. The evolving regulations aim to ensure integrity and transparency within the organic market, fostering trust among consumers.
Key trends shaping organic farming standards include:
- Increased Regulatory Scrutiny: Agencies are tightening standards to combat fraud and ensure compliance, leading to higher accountability in organic certifications.
- Focus on Biodiversity: New standards recognize the importance of biodiversity in ecosystems, encouraging practices that maintain diverse crops and promote resilient agricultural systems.
- Integration of Technology: Advanced technologies like blockchain are being explored to enhance traceability and supply chain transparency in organic farming.
Moreover, the advent of climate-smart practices is becoming crucial. These involve methods that reduce carbon footprints while adhering to organic principles, addressing both sustainability and environmental impact. Legal Implications of Violating Organic Farming Standards
Violating organic farming standards carries significant legal implications that can impact farmers, businesses, and consumers alike. These standards, designed to ensure the integrity of organic products, are enforced by regulatory bodies at both state and national levels. Non-compliance can lead to various repercussions, including fines, loss of certification, and even legal action.
When a farmer fails to adhere to the established organic farming standards, the consequences may include civil penalties imposed by certifying agents. These penalties serve to protect consumers from misleading claims regarding organic products. In severe cases, criminal charges may be brought against individuals or entities that deliberately misrepresent their farming practices.
Moreover, legal actions can arise from consumers who may pursue lawsuits if they believe they have been deceived. Such actions not only harm the reputation of the involved parties but can also lead to financial losses. Furthermore, businesses may face recalls or litigation, contributing to broader economic impacts within the agricultural sector.
